The Department's description
Exterior description and setting
A rock-faced granite block wall with gabled and oversailing copings between square terminal piers. Cast iron plaque inset depicts a Primate seated between two Yew trees; inscribed below with the words: ‘Jubin Cjnn Tracta’. Towards the base of the wall is a black polished granite plaque within a Gothic surround which has alternating black and grey granite voussoirs. Inscribed white letters read ‘In proud and loving memory of the patriots of Cochron and Iowans of Newry and all those from the town and district whose lives were sacrificed in the cause of freedom in 1798. Erected 1948 by the Newry Ninty-eight Commemoration Committee.’
Historical information
The original HMBB survey sheet (dated 11 November 1969) states that this memorial was originally a drinking fountain. A potato and fowl market is shown here on the 1899 OS map, and the wall may originally have been part of the boundary to these premises.

Evaluation
A rock-faced granite block wall with cast iron plaque. Of little architectural merit, it commemorates an important time in Irish and local history. It does not meet the statutory and policy tests as a building of special architectural or historic interest. The Conservation Area is an appropriate level of protection.
